There are many home remedies for cavities that can help you get rid of the annoying condition.

Think of cavities as tiny black holes on your teeth. They start when bacteria, feasting on your mouth's sugars, grow on your teeth.

Streptococcus mutans, a usual suspect, leads to the creation of these cavities. They make acid, which eats your teeth's enamel. Catching cavities early is the key to avoiding major issues.

Poor dental care mainly causes tooth decay and cavities, which are common issues. Ignoring them might lead to severe tooth pain, infections, and, sadly, losing teeth.

1) Oil pulling

Oil pulling is an Ayurvedic practice that promotes oral hygiene. One of the many studies undertaken revealed that oil pulling decreases the quantity of germs in the mouth and plaque production, potentially preventing decay from occurring in the future.

In this process, a small amount of pure coconut oil, sesame oil or sunflower oil (ideally cold-pressed) is swished about in the mouth to coat all of the teeth.

This technique should be performed in the morning on an empty stomach before cleaning the teeth. There is still room for greater research on the advantages of oil pulling.

2) Vitamin D

Vitamin D has an important function in maintaining dental health. It promotes calcium absorption and the generation of antimicrobial peptides.

To avoid periodontal disease and cavities, it is vital to consume a Vitamin D-rich diet, including meals such as fatty fish and yolks from eggs, along with cheese. If you intend to take more pills for this vitamin, see your doctor.

3) Saltwater gargle

After a meal, mix salt and warm water and gargle with it. Saltwater removes adhesion from the teeth, which proves to be efficient.

When an injury or illness develops in the mouth, oral health practitioners frequently advise patients to use saltwater. Saltwater can even eliminate microorganisms that cause cavities.

4) Green tea

Simple green tea is beneficial for your teeth. It battles nasty microorganisms in the mouth and strengthens your teeth. It also tastes excellent and helps avoid cavities. Green tea contains antioxidants that have powerful bacteria-killing effects. Additionally, drinking green tea reduces the pH level of saliva as well as tooth plaque.

5) Toothpaste

Fluoride toothpaste has been shown to help remineralize decayed teeth. However, excessive fluoride consumption has been linked to decreased IQ, bone fluorosis, hypertension, birth abnormalities, and other health problems.

Natural toothpastes that contain essential oils, prebiotics, and other necessary vitamins may benefit your oral health, particularly if they have natural antibacterial as well as anti-inflammatory characteristics.

6) Garlic

Garlic is not only an excellent flavor enhancer, but it is also a nutritional powerhouse. Consuming raw garlic is also very good for your oral health. It contains antifungal and antibacterial characteristics, which function as a painkiller.

Chopping raw garlic releases a chemical known as allicin. It is powerful against bacteria, and can help prevent cavities and other oral illnesses.

7) Mouthwash

Fluoride treatment is an excellent approach for strengthening teeth and replenishing lost nutrients. Because a lack of minerals may contribute to tooth damage, including fluoride mouthwash in your oral hygiene routine can be an effective home remedy for preventing cavities and decay.

8) Vitamin C

Lemon contains Vitamin C and acids, which help destroy bacteria and relieve pain. As a result, you may use lemon to clean the teeth, reduce toothache, and even avoid cavities. Chew a piece of lemon in the mouth, then rinse with water. Vitamin C is beneficial for both your teeth and your gums.

Vitamin C assists in making the connective cells in the gums strong and healthy, which keep your teeth in place — so deficiency can cause bleeding gums and cavities.

We discovered that sugar is the most common cause of cavities, along with tooth decay.

Eating carbs (mainly sugar and starches) like milk, candy, soda, and cakes feeds the bacteria in the mouth. That bacteria generates acids, which eventually erode your enamel.

The end product is a cavity. That is why sugar promotes cavities, and avoiding it can improve your oral health in a variety of ways. Alternatively, proper dental hygiene might remove the microorganisms.
